Flood Risk
High Flood Risk
Buyers in Bangsud should treat flood risk as a primary — not secondary — due diligence item. Tago carries a high flood-risk rating, and this barangay shares that profile. Request DRRMO flood history records, inspect drainage proximity, verify the property's floor level above the nearest waterway, and consider whether flood insurance is available.

Is there a rental market in Bangsud, Tago?
Rental demand in Bangsud follows Tago's employment base: local workers and families seeking affordable, accessible accommodation are the primary rental market. Proximity to employment centers and public transport is the key factor determining rental demand in any specific unit.
What rental returns can I expect from a property in Bangsud?
Rental returns in Bangsud depend on property type, condition, and location within the barangay. As a general guide, established market properties typically yield 4–6% gross from a stable local tenant base. Actual returns vary — verify comparables with a local property manager before projecting income.
